CVE-2026-74352

Опубликовано: 15 авг. 2026
Источник: redhat
CVSS3: 5.5

Описание

In the Linux kernel, the following vulnerability has been resolved: of: reserved_mem: avoid post-init UAF when alloc_reserved_mem_array() fails The global pointer 'reserved_mem' continues to reference the reserved_mem_array which lives in __initdata if alloc_reserved_mem_array() fails. of_reserved_mem_lookup() is exported for post-init use, that would dereference freed memory and trigger a use-after-free. So reset reserved_mem_count to 0 when alloc_reserved_mem_array() fails.

A flaw was found in the Linux kernel's reserved memory management. During initialization, if the allocation of the reserved memory array fails, a global pointer may still reference the freed memory. A subsequent operation, such as looking up reserved memory, could then attempt to access this freed memory, leading to a use-after-free vulnerability. This could result in system instability or a denial of service.
